ubuntu 查看报错

Ubuntu中查看错误信息,可使用终端命令查看系统日志,如“cat /var/log/syslog”或使用“journalctl”命令,以快速诊断系统问题。

在使用Ubuntu操作系统时,遇到报错是难免的,查看报错信息可以帮助我们快速定位问题,从而找到解决方案,以下将详细阐述在Ubuntu中查看报错的方法和技巧。

ubuntu 查看报错
(图片来源网络,侵删)

我们要明确一点,报错信息通常分为两种:一种是命令行报错,另一种是图形界面报错,针对这两种情况,我们可以采用不同的方法来查看报错信息。

1、命令行报错

当我们在终端执行命令时,如果发生错误,通常会看到错误信息输出到终端,以下是一些查看命令行报错的方法:

(1)直接查看终端输出

当命令执行错误时,错误信息会直接显示在终端。

“`

$ sudo aptget update

W: GPG error: http://archive.ubuntu.com/ubuntu xenial InRelease: The following signatures couldn’t be verified because the public key is not available: NO_PUBKEY 40976EAF437D05B5 NO_PUBKEY 3B4FE6ACC0B21F32

“`

这个例子中,W: 开头的行表示警告信息,告诉我们缺少公钥,导致无法验证某些软件包的签名。

(2)使用 2>&1 将错误信息重定向到标准输出

有时,错误信息可能被重定向到其他地方,或者我们希望将错误信息与标准输出一同查看,这时可以使用 2>&1 将错误信息重定向到标准输出。

“`

$ sudo aptget update 2>&1 | tee update.log

“`

这个命令将错误信息与标准输出同时显示在终端,并将所有输出保存到 update.log 文件。

(3)使用 grep 过滤错误信息

当输出内容较多时,可以使用 grep 命令过滤出错误信息。

“`

$ tail f /var/log/syslog | grep error

“`

这个命令会实时显示包含 "error" 关键词的日志信息。

2、图形界面报错

图形界面报错通常出现在应用程序崩溃或者系统出现问题时,以下是一些查看图形界面报错的方法:

(1)查看应用程序的输出

在图形界面中,当应用程序崩溃时,通常会有一个弹窗显示错误信息,如果需要进一步查看详细信息,可以将错误信息保存到文件。

对于许多使用Qt框架的应用程序,可以在命令行中使用以下命令查看崩溃报告:

“`

$ cat ~/.config/QtProject/qterrors.err

“`

(2)查看系统日志

系统日志文件中通常包含了许多关于系统运行状况的信息,包括图形界面报错,可以使用以下命令查看相关日志:

“`

$ cat /var/log/Xorg.0.log

“`

这个日志文件记录了Xorg服务器的运行信息,对于图形界面相关问题非常有用。

还可以查看以下日志文件:

/var/log/syslog:包含系统级别的日志信息。

/var/log/kern.log:包含内核日志信息。

/var/log/messages:包含系统和服务器的消息。

(3)使用图形界面工具

Ubuntu提供了许多图形界面工具来查看系统日志和报错信息,可以使用以下工具:

System Log:系统日志查看器,可以在菜单中搜索 "System Log" 打开。

Apport:应用程序崩溃报告工具,当应用程序崩溃时,通常会自动弹出一个窗口,询问是否发送崩溃报告。

在Ubuntu中查看报错信息是一项基本技能,了解各种查看方法和技巧,可以帮助我们更快地定位问题,从而提高解决问题的效率,希望本文的内容对您有所帮助。

原创文章,作者:酷盾叔,如若转载,请注明出处:https://www.kdun.com/ask/291713.html

(0)
酷盾叔的头像酷盾叔订阅
上一篇 2024-03-02 04:55
下一篇 2024-03-02 04:56

相关推荐

  • 如何在CentOS中使用journalctl查看系统日志

    在CentOS中使用journalctl查看系统日志journalctl是systemd系统管理守护进程的日志工具,用于查询系统日志,以下是在CentOS中使用journalctl查看系统日志的详细步骤。1. 打开终端在CentOS系统中,可以通过以下方式打开终端:按下Ctrl + Alt + T组合键点击应用……

    2024-05-18
    0129
  • 查看iis报错系统日志

    在Windows服务器上使用IIS(Internet Information Services)时,遇到网站或应用程序错误是常见的情况,为了帮助管理员诊断和解决问题,IIS提供了详细的错误日志系统,下面我们将详细讨论如何查看IIS报错系统日志。了解IIS日志IIS日志是记录Web服务器上发生的事件的数据文件,这些日志文件通常以.log……

    2024-03-22
    0654
  • 如何在Ubuntu中打开一个终端窗口

    在Ubuntu中打开一个终端窗口,可以通过以下几种方法:1、快捷键 按下Ctrl + Alt + T组合键,即可快速打开一个终端窗口。2、菜单栏 点击屏幕左上角的应用程序图标,展开应用程序列表,找到系统工具分类,点击终端图标,即可打开一个终端窗口。3、搜索功能 点击屏幕左上角的放大镜图标,输入关键词“终端”,在……

    2024-05-18
    0193
  • 在阿里云上部署Minecraft服务器,应该选择哪种操作系统?

    对于Minecraft服务器,建议在阿里云上选择Linux操作系统,如Ubuntu或CentOS,因为Linux系统更加稳定且资源占用较低。Minecraft服务器软件也对Linux有更好的支持。

    2024-08-04
    022

发表回复

您的电子邮箱地址不会被公开。 必填项已用 * 标注

免费注册
电话联系

400-880-8834

产品咨询
产品咨询
分享本页
返回顶部
云产品限时秒杀。精选云产品高防服务器,20M大带宽限量抢购  >>点击进入